ASX – Citi rates the stock as Sell

And yet again the ASX delivered a better-than-expected interim performance, but Citi analysts still cannot get past its valuation. Estimates have been lifted by 2%-3% and take some comfort from guidance towards further lower costs.

Citi analysts fully acknowledge the ASX’s defensive qualities on top of its positive leverage to higher market volatility, but they cannot get past the valuation. Sell. Price target lifts to $61.40 from $59.80.

Sector: Diversified Financials.

Target price is $61.40.Current Price is $68.19. Difference: ($6.79) – (brackets indicate current price is over target). If ASX meets the Citi target it will return approximately -11% (excluding dividends, fees and charges – negative figures indicate an expected loss).
